European Antimicrobial Resistance Surveillance Network (EARS-Net) 

EARS-Net is a European wide network of national surveillance systems, providing European reference data on antimicrobial resistance for public health purposes. The network is coordinated and  funded by the European Centre for Disease Prevention and Control

The coordination of EARS-Net, the European Antimicrobial Resistance Surveillance Network (former EARSS), was transferred from the Dutch National Institute for Public Health and the Environment (RIVM) to the European Centre for Disease Prevention and Control (ECDC) in January 2010.

The surveillance of antimicrobial resistance within the EU is carried out in agreement with Decision No 2119/98/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 24 September 1998 and Regulation (EC) no 851/2004 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 21 April 2004 establishing a European Centre for Disease Prevention and Control.
